Sahil Kumar

Over four months, contributed to the harness/uicore repository by designing and implementing new UI icons and refining icon rendering for enhanced user experience. Focused on front end development and iconography, the work included delivering icons for resilience management, dry run tests, and the RT module, as well as improving visual clarity and consistency across dashboards. Addressed a Gameday icon display bug by updating asset versions, ensuring reliable branding. Technical improvements involved transitioning chaos icons to path fill rendering and removing fixed sizing constraints, supporting responsive design. Utilized TypeScript, SVG, and JSON to maintain scalable, maintainable, and visually consistent UI components.

February 2026 — Harness/uicore: Icon rendering improvements for Chaos icons delivered to improve visual consistency, responsiveness, and maintainability. Replaced stroke-based rendering with path fill and removed fixed height/width constraints to support flexible icon sizing across themes and devices. Two commits (CHAOS-10919 and CHAOS-10729) captured these changes, adding foundational improvements for icon standardization and future UI consistency.
